While 3D printing has opened up an entirely new medium in visual art, it's been mostly separate from more traditional art forms like painting. Georgia company Verus Art, however, is blurring the lines by using 3D scanning and printing to create fully textured reproductions of famous paintings, and they've just introduced a new collection of twelve paintings reproduced from the National Gallery of Canada. The collection includes several works from textural masters Van Gogh and Monet, as well as other European luminaries such as Degas, Gauguin, Cézanne and Canadian painters Tom Thomson and Frederick Varley.
